Athlon Sports' response to my E-mail


Guest BasketBull.

Recommended Posts

Guest BasketBull.

Thanks for your email and your comments. South Florida is a unique situation

for us, being a 'out-of-region team,' for lack of a better term. We have

difficulty getting enough facings on newsstands (meaning the amount of

different magazines); there simply isn't enough room for our ACC (Florida

State), SEC (Florida), National, NFL and Eastern. Our circulation department

is trying to figure out ways to get our Eastern Magazine on the stands in

the Tampa area.

Two or three years ago, we offered an Internet-only South Florida magazine

and it didn't sell as well as we had hoped. Starting next year, we are going

to offer Custom Covers, meaning that if we get 1,000 pre-orders (or more),

we will put South Florida (or any school) on the cover for purchase on our

website.

Thanks for your comments. Good luck to the Bulls.

I got the identical response to my first e-mail. I sent a follow up mentioning the sales of the Andre Hall edition and the fact that UConn is on the cover of two editions (Eastern and National). She didn't address sales of the Hall cover, but said this about UConn:

The national covers are sold regionally, too (if that makes sense). Our National mag with Rutgers and UConn is only sold in the Northeast. It has Tebow on it too, because he is the Heisman winner. The Eastern Regional edition with UConn and SU is only sold in NY and Conn.

Thanks again. I do appreciate your interest in Athlon.
